What's going through my mind when I wake up in the morning, on my way to work, when I drink coffee with friends, when I shop for groceries in the supermarket? Which of these things do I speak out loud, what do I keep for myself?

LIFESTRIPS are autobiographical graphic stories that recount seemingly trivial and mundane moments of daily life in the form of staged or semi-documentary picture series. Accurately observing their own thoughts and feelings, the authors tell affectionately and ironically of the absurdity of everyday life. An experimental and personal project of Marc Seestaedt and Katharina Anna Helming.
